Warmth, protection, and good luck.

DC Donon 13 Insulated Pants keep you warm and dry with water-resistant polyester fabric and light synthetic insulation. The baggy fit lets you layer underneath and the 13 means you can break mirrors and walk under ladders while wearing the Donon 13.

  • 10K waterproofing holds off light rain and snow
  • Lightweight synthetic insulation keeps you warm even if it gets wet
  • Huge cargo pockets for tons of storage space
  • Critical seams taped to eliminate waterproof weak spots
  • Brushed mesh lining wicks moisture and promotes airflow to eliminate clamminess
  • Waist- and boot-gaiter seals out snow and drafts
  • Lift pass hook for easy access
